2009 Cadillac XLR vs. 2004 Chevrolet Suburban
To start off, 2009 Cadillac XLR is newer by 5 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2004 Chevrolet Suburban.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2004 Chevrolet Suburban would be higher. At 5,965 cc (8 cylinders), 2004 Chevrolet Suburban is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2004 Chevrolet Suburban (325 HP @ 5600 RPM) has 3 more horse power than 2009 Cadillac XLR. (322 HP @ 6450 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2004 Chevrolet Suburban should accelerate faster than 2009 Cadillac XLR.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2004 Chevrolet Suburban weights approximately 937 kg more than 2009 Cadillac XLR.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2004 Chevrolet Suburban is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2009 Cadillac XLR.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2004 Chevrolet Suburban will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2004 Chevrolet Suburban (495 Nm) has 72 more torque (in Nm) than 2009 Cadillac XLR. (423 Nm). This means 2004 Chevrolet Suburban will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2009 Cadillac XLR.
Compare all specifications:
2009 Cadillac XLR | 2004 Chevrolet Suburban | |
Make | Cadillac | Chevrolet |
Model | XLR | Suburban |
Year Released | 2009 | 2004 |
Body Type | Convertible | SUV |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 4565 cc | 5965 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 8 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| V |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 2 valves |
Horse Power | 322 HP | 325 HP |
Engine RPM | 6450 RPM | 5600 RPM |
Torque | 423 Nm | 495 Nm |
Engine Bore Size | 93 mm | 102 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 84 mm | 92 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 10.5:1 | 9.4:1 |
Drive Type | Rear | 4WD |
Number of Seats | 2 seats | 9 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1722 kg | 2659 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4520 mm | 5580 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1840 mm | 2030 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1290 mm | 1950 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2690 mm | 3310 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 68 L | 142 L |
